The Pickup and Transportation
Your journey begins at Wielopole 2, a convenient meeting point in Kraków’s Old Town. The trip itself takes about 1 hour and 45 minutes each way, which is worth noting for those who dislike long transfers. The English-speaking driver is a highlight, offering not only safe transport but also insights and local tips throughout the ride. As one review put it, “the driver was brilliant” and went “the extra mile” in making the trip enjoyable.
Transporting groups in a comfortable coach, the ride offers a chance to relax and anticipate the upcoming aquatic delight. The return journey is equally smooth, bringing you back to your original meeting point with minimal fuss.
The Thermal Baths: What to Expect
Once at the Chocholowskie Thermal Baths, you’ll have about 3 hours to enjoy everything on offer. The complex boasts over 30 pools, including bubbling jacuzzis and salt pools, along with options such as dry saunas and a salt cave—all designed to promote relaxation and wellness.
The pools are set in a scenic outdoor setting, often with views of nature that enhance the calming atmosphere. You might find that the saline pools and salt cave offer unique health benefits, a feature especially appealing for those interested in holistic wellness.

Additional Costs and Practical Details
While the main experience is comprehensive, some amenities come with extra fees, such as towels (10 PLN) or sauna shows (40 PLN). Swimsuits and flip-flops are also sold on-site. The three-hour window, while sufficient for most, might feel rushed if you intend to explore every corner or indulge in multiple treatments.

Frequently Asked Questions
How long is the trip from Kraków to the thermal baths?
The journey takes about 1 hour and 45 minutes each way, making it a manageable transfer for most travelers.
What is included in the ticket?
Your ticket grants access to over 30 pools, jacuzzis, salt pools, salt cave, dry saunas, and the 16+ relaxation zone. It also includes entry to therapeutic sulphur waters.
Are there any additional costs I should be aware of?
Yes, towels (10 PLN) and sauna shows (40 PLN) are extra. Swimsuits and flip-flops are also sold on-site if you don’t bring your own.
Is transportation wheelchair accessible?
Yes, this activity is wheelchair accessible, making it suitable for visitors with mobility needs.
Can I cancel the tour?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ans change.
